Today, I saw Dr Silver again.  My BP was still the highest it's been all pregnancy (as it has been for the past week), but I am not spilling protein.  This is important because it means I have not developed pre-eclampsia.  If I were to spill protein, they would induce me rather quickly.  I have lost 2.5 lbs this week, which is surprising because I haven't left the house and have been eating Graeter's ice cream each day.

The pelvic exam revealed I was 50-60% effaced and between a 1 & 2 station, but still only dilated to 1cm.  This was welcome news because Chris isn't scheduled to get in until early Saturday.  Dr Silver was very surprised at how low Amelia is sitting - he poked her in the head again. 

The biggest news is that, due to my continued high BP, ripened cervix, and other factors, I will be induced this coming Tuesday, September 21, if I have not gone yet.  Yes - no later than Tuesday night, there will be a baby!

Today, I went in for my 38 wk appt.  I saw Dr Silver, who will be my doctor for the duration.  He was very nice, asked lots of questions, and was calm.  Vitals are good (although BP still up at 134/95).  I am positive for Group B Strep, which means I will receive IV antibiotics when admitted.

I had my first pelvic check and whoa was I unprepared for it.  Let's just say that area has been closed for business for awhile and I hadn't mentally prepared myself.  He laughed and asked if I realized I'd be giving birth soon.  Afterwards, I had some mild cramping, but nothing too bad.

Turns out, I am 1cm dilated, 50% effaced, and at a +1 station.  He couldn't quit remarking how low she was and he felt the top of her head.  Apparently, she's dropped (as both Chris and my dad had suggested), but I haven't noticed.  This would explain the sharp, shooting pains I've been feeling in my cervix - she's a headbutter.  I could stay like this for weeks or she could come today.  Due to my vitals and high-risk status, I will be induced b/t 39-40 wks if I haven't given birth yet.  Dr Silver does not want me to develop pre-eclampsia (and frankly, can't believe I haven't yet with all the symptoms I have).

It's been an eventful few days.  I have been having some cramping and, at night, lower back pain.  I went in for my 36ish appt on Weds with a different doctor.  I had gained 3 lbs in 3 wks, baby's heart rate was good, and the nurse administered the routine Strep B test.  All good news, except my BP was 149/101 and 152/101!  (It has been baselining around 135/90).  The nurse was kinda freaking and, after a quick vitals check, went to get the dr.

I mentioned my new symptoms to the dr: increased swelling, headache lasting for 29 days, cramping, etc. and he asked "Are you just trying to get yourself induced?"  I informed him it was quite the opposite...that I was trying to NOT give birth for two more wks.  He was worried about my headaches and hypothesized it could be cranial hypertension.  He sent me over to the head of ophthalmology to be checked.  Thankfully, I passed all his tests and ruled that out.

I was sent straight to antepartum testing for a non-stress test a day early.  After sitting for an hour, my pressures came down to my baseline and Amelia didn't seem to be in any distress.   Like Monday, though, she did not want to wake up.  (The nurses establish a baseline and the baby's heartrate is to accelerate at least twice and she is to move at least twice within the time frame.)  We tried moving me, eating, and drinking, before the nurse buzzed her awake.  She wasn't too fond of that.  I also had blood/urine labs done - which all came back normal.  I'm doing another 24 hr pee test (my fave!) currently.

The doctors are watching very closely.  I had to start preparing my brain yesterday for the potential of giving birth without Chris.  Even typing those words brings tears to my eyes.  Hopefully, my pressures continue to stabilize and Amelia simmers for two more wks. 

Today, I had a biophysical profile (aka: big fancy ultrasound) to check her growth.  She is head down, with a head circumference of ~32 cm, a femur length of ~7cm, normal amniotic fluid levels, and is still a girl.  Her bottom lip was pouting out and she had a full bladder.  Her knees were pulled up to her chest and her hand was resting on my placenta.  Her estimated gestational age was 36w6d, which is a rare perfect "score".
